Bandelier National Monument
Photo: Brian0918, Public domain.
Bandelier National Monument is a national monument in the North Central region of New Mexico. It was once inhabited by the ancient Puebloans, the ancestors of some of the modern-day Native American pueblos of northern New Mexico.

White Rock
Town
Photo: Chyeburashka, CC BY 2.5.
White Rock is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Los Alamos County, New Mexico. It is one of two major population centers in the county; the other is Los Alamos. White Rock is situated 6 miles northeast of Bandelier Weather Station.
